About Wisconsin School of Professional Psychology

A practitioner-founded institution offering a focused path in clinical psychology.

The Wisconsin School of Professional Psychology (WSPP) stands as a unique institution, born from a visionary initiative in 1978. A group of southeastern Wisconsin psychologists, recognizing an unmet demand for clinical professionals, established WSPP with a clear mission: to cultivate the next generation of highly skilled psychologists. This practical, real-world foundation ensured that from its very first cohort of students in 1980, the education provided was deeply rooted in the realities of professional practice.

WSPP's commitment to excellence is evident in its robust academic framework and dedicated faculty. Initially, its teaching staff comprised practicing psychologists from Milwaukee, bringing invaluable clinical experience directly into the classroom. This hands-on, practitioner-led approach remains a cornerstone of its educational philosophy. Further solidifying its reputation, WSPP proudly holds accreditation from both the North Central Association of Colleges and Schools (NCA) since 1987 and the esteemed American Psychological Association (APA), signifying its adherence to rigorous academic standards and professional credibility.
